K Club ( Palmer )
This is big , glamorous parkland golf . Lakes , streams , rivers , ancient trees , lazy rhythm … and lots and lots of space . The Palmer course at the K Club carries an enormous reputation for its design pedigree ( Arnold Palmer ) and for the events it has hosted ( Ryder Cup and European Opens ). It is no surprise that it promises all the frills and thrills you could ask for . The River Liffey squeezes some holes but many other water features abound on this gently rolling Kildare landscape . Despite such volumes of water this is a relaxing round of golf with generous fairways and big greens . You probably won ’ t even mind depositing a ball in the Liffey on the par five 16th … countless others have done the very same . It is not a tough course but be sure to choose your tees wisely . The middle White tees measure 6,815 yards ; the forward Green tees measure 6,240 yards .
